THE OPPORTUNITY: Occupational Medicine Physician

THE LOCATION: Medford and Grants Pass, Oregon

Permanent / full time / employed



Ready for a change? We have an exciting opportunity available for an Emergency Medicine Physician to join our team in Medford, Oregon. You will be responsible for treating and managing Worker’s Compensation claims and managing patients for the duration of their Work Comp claim. In addition, you will perform Department of Transportation physicals as well as physicals for non-DOT related needs. You will be the liaison for the community and will also act as a Medical Review Officer for the clinic’s drug screening program, working in Medford and Grants Pass, Oregon. Located in the picturesque Rogue River valley and nestled between the Cascade and Siskiyou Mountains, the valley is in the “rain shadow” of the mountains and avoids much of the famous Pacific Northwest moisture. The mild, four-season climate offers warm summers, mild winters, beautiful springtime displays, and exquisite fall colors.
